Health Statistics > Flu shot (most recent) by state

Rank   States  Amount  (top to bottom)   
#1   Colorado: 78.8% 
#2   Minnesota: 78.2% 
#3   South Dakota: 76.8% 
#4   Nebraska: 75.8% 
#5   Utah: 75.4% 
#6   Oklahoma: 74.9% 
#7   Wisconsin: 74.2% 
#8   North Dakota: 74.2% 
#9   Iowa: 74% 
#10   Wyoming: 73.8% 
#11   Rhode Island: 73% 
#12   Connecticut: 73% 
#13   New Mexico: 72.3% 
#14   Montana: 72.1% 
#15   Maine: 72.1% 
#16   Oregon: 71% 
#17   California: 70.9% 
#18   New Hampshire: 70.7% 
#19   Massachusetts: 70.5% 
#20   Delaware: 69.2% 
#21   Missouri: 69.1% 
#22   Arkansas: 68.7% 
#23   Louisiana: 68.6% 
#24   Virginia: 68.6% 
#25   Kansas: 68.1% 
#26   Washington: 67.9% 
#27   West Virginia: 67.8% 
#28   Ohio: 67.5% 
#29   New Jersey: 67.5% 
#30   Texas: 67% 
#31   Michigan: 66.9% 
#32   North Carolina: 66.9% 
#33   Mississippi: 66.8% 
#34   Vermont: 66.6% 
#35   Tennessee: 66.3% 
#36   Idaho: 66.1% 
#37   Alabama: 66.1% 
#38   Arizona: 66.1% 
#39   South Carolina: 66% 
#40   New York: 65.9% 
#41   Illinois: 65.3% 
#42   Florida: 65.1% 
#43   Maryland: 64.6% 
#44   Georgia: 64.4% 
#45   Indiana: 64.2% 
#46   Kentucky: 64.2% 
#47   Alaska: 64.1% 
#48   Pennsylvania: 63.8% 
#49   Nevada: 59% 
#50   District of Columbia: 54.8% 
#51   US Virgin Islands: 39.3% 
#52   Puerto Rico: 35.3% 
Weighted average: 67.7%  


DEFINITION: Adults aged 65+ who have had a flu shot within the past year.

SOURCE: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C). Behavioral Risk Factor Surveillance System Survey Data. Atlanta, Georgia: U.S. Department of Health and Human Services,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, 2004.
